Sat 763930630892859

decimal
152786.630892859
degree
0°152786′1586″630892859‴
percentile
36.377649130151575%
name
ilayexufwyo
cycle
0
epoch
0
period
75
block
152786
offset
630892859
timestamp
rarity
common